CHEF UP!
by Christina Akira Yoh

This article was written by high school student Christina Akira Yoh.


Senior Elizabeth Frey and I released a recipe app called Chef Up! which provides users with healthy, low cost, tasty, and easy-to-make recipes that can all be made in a college dorm room. 

The idea for this application came about because among our peers, we saw a lack of ability to quickly make nutritional snacks. Going into college, we both believe that it is important to develop healthy, nutritious eating habits early. It was clear that the solution was to create a phone application that shares easily accessible, healthy, and simple-to-create recipes. Who doesn’t carry their phone around with them?

Both of us, through our experience as high school varsity athletes, deeply value the importance of eating healthy. With the transition to college, we both hope to continue maintaining healthy living and eating habits. Having a shared desire to help others as well as a penchant for entrepreneurship, we wanted to make something in which we could share our knowledge with our peers. Combining our expertise and interests in nutrition/recipe development (Christina) and computer science/app development (Elizabeth), we decided to take on the challenge of creating a simple but effective recipe app that college students can take wherever they go. Our aim is to empower college students to develop healthy lifestyle habits—one recipe at a time. 

As a result, we spent the past four months through our Catalyst class working together to make this idea a reality. On my end, it took tens of hours of research about nutrition and hundreds of trials of different recipes, while on Elizabeth’s end that meant tons of research about how to create an app and hours of prototyping, creating, and testing. Through lots of hard work and constant communication, we were finally able to publish an application we are proud of! 

On the first day of our app’s launch, it reached the 44th spot on the Food and Drink charts, which was a huge success!
